Material Notes:
PRE-ELEC ESD 7120 is a static dissipative thermoplastic compound based on ABS. The dissipative property is permanent and built into the polymer chain. PRE-ELEC ESD 7120 has been developed for injection molding and for the extrusion of thermoformable mono- or multi-layer sheet. The products made out of PRE-ELEC ESD 7120 are transparent, washable, reusable and recyclable. Surface resistance values of 108 ohms (EOS/ESD S11.11-1993, IEC 61340-5-1) can be achieved with optimum processing parameters.Typical applications include trays, tote bins, crates and technical parts which give permanent ESD protection for the electronics, medical, pharmaceutical and paper handling industries. PRE-ELEC ESD 7120 can also be used as covers and lids as it is transparent.Information provided by Premix Thermoplastics Inc.
